Auburn is adding significant muscle to the trenches. The Tigers' 2027 recruiting class grew stronger on Sunday with the addition of four-star defensive lineman Nate Kamba.

Strengthening the Defensive Front

Kamba’s commitment brings the Tigers' 2027 class to 18 total players. The decision came shortly after he completed an official visit to the Plains, where he ultimately chose Auburn over a competitive field that included Ohio State, Georgia, and South Carolina.

The North Carolina native, who attends Corvian Community High School in Charlotte, stands at 6-foot-4 and 300 pounds. According to the 247Sports composite, Kamba is rated as the No. 270 overall prospect in the country and the 32nd-best defensive lineman. He becomes the second defensive lineman to join the class, pairing up with fellow four-star recruit and in-state talent Donivan Moore.

Recruiting Momentum

With Kamba officially on board, Auburn continues to climb the charts. The 2027 cycle for the Tigers now sits at 14th nationally in the 247Sports team recruiting rankings, placing the program fifth among SEC schools as reported by 205focus.com.
